Summary
My first reaction on starting to read your new book was that it was important and was your testament. It is full of interest and excitement and it conveys a clear account of your credible view of evolution. The good feeling lasted throughout the book but I do have some reservations about Chapter 8. It could be the best of your books and I am glad to have had the chance to read it. I have written a ‘buddy blurb’ as follows.
